Fried Shrimp with Spicy Salt

Ingredients

  1. 1.1 lbsshrimp
  2. 7 tablespoonsall-purpose flour
  3. 4 tablespoonstapioca flour⁣
  4. 1 1/2 tablespoonsoyster sauce
  5. 1egg⁣
  6. 3 tablespoonssesame oil
  7. Seasoning:
  8. 7 clovesgarlic, minced
  9. 2red bird's eye chilies, thinly sliced⁣
  10. 3large red chilies, chopped⁣
  11. 1green onion, thinly sliced⁣
  12. 2kaffir lime leaves, thinly sliced⁣
  13. 1 stalklemongrass⁣
  14. 1/2 teaspoonpepper
  15. 1/2 teaspoonsalt⁣
  16. 3 tablespoonscooking oil

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Mix the tapioca flour, all-purpose flour, and salt. Stir well.⁣

  2. 2

    Place the shrimp in a bowl, add the oyster sauce, egg, and pepper. Mix and let sit for 10 minutes.⁣

  3. 3

    Coat the shrimp with the flour mixture. ⁣

  4. 4

    Heat the oil and fry the coated shrimp until golden brown, then set aside.

  5. 5

    Sauté the cooking oil and garlic together until fragrant. ⁣

  6. 6

    Add the lemongrass, bird's eye chilies, chopped large red chilies, kaffir lime leaves, and green onion. Stir well. ⁣

  7. 7

    Add the fried shrimp to the sautéed seasoning. Add pepper and salt, stir briefly, turn off the heat, and serve.⁣
